## Deploying the Gatewick Proctor Queue

Deploys are pretty painless: push to main, wait for the pipeline, then watch the queue drain dashboard for five minutes. If candidates pile up mid-exam, roll back first and ask questions later — the queue replays safely. Everything the workers care about lives in one config block, shown here for reference.

settings of bafof-yagef:
JOROX_PIN=8740
JOROX_TENANT=pelox
JOROX_METRICS_HOST=metrics.jorox.qorvelworks.internal
JOROX_SEAL=seal_c78f63c1
JOROX_STANDBY_TEAM=norax

**Notes — Gridsmith sync, Tuesday.** We agreed the crossword generator's fill algorithm needs a rewrite before themed puzzles ship; the current backtracker chokes on grids over 21x21. Word-list scoring stays as-is for now. Someone should document the clue-pairing heuristics before the old code is deleted — future maintainers will thank us. Action item: open a design doc by Friday. The person on the hook for that doc and the rewrite is:

named custodian: Brivan Eliath Quenox Frador

Subject: On-call coverage — Bexley partner SFTP drop

Heads up for the release window: the Bexley partner drops files to our SFTP landing zone nightly around 02:00. If the pickup job misses a file, do not rename anything in the drop folder — rerun the pickup with the replay flag instead. The full procedure and validation checklist are on the page below.

wiki page, tahaf-tajog: https://jira.ordindyn.corp/pipeline

**Handover Note — Thornbury Retail Pilot**

Dela, taking over from me on the Thornbury & Vale pilot — here's the short version for the branch managers. Twelve stores are live with the Lanternfish checkout kit; footfall conversion is up roughly 6% in the Harwick cluster. Stock sync still hiccups on Sunday restocks, so keep logging those. Thornbury's ops lead wants a decision on the remaining forty stores by month-end. Keep this circle tight — the wider plan sits in the confidential note below.

internal memo for bahap-yagug: Headcount on the Ulaix team goes from 3 to 100 by the end of January. Gross margin on Ulaix came in at 10 percent against a plan of 15 percent.